- [ ] Step 7: Archive cold storage buckets (Glacierline tier). Confirm both ceremony witnesses are present, verify bucket manifests match the Oxbow ledger, then seal the archive key shares. Plugin authors may observe but not handle shares. Once sealed, the archive index itself is encrypted and can only be reopened with the passphrase below.

vault phrase of badup-hahig = tamael-aldael-kelmir-istael-fenok-istwyn-tamius-jorath-oliion

- [ ] **Step 7: Breaker override escrow.** After sealing the signing keys for the Tallgrove upstream API circuit breaker, confirm the support team can force the breaker open during a full outage. The override bundle lives in the sealed escrow drawer and is useless without its unlock phrase. Two ceremony witnesses must initial this step before proceeding. The escrow bundle is decrypted with the recovery passphrase that follows.

vault phrase of kahip-kahop = holath-quenmir

## Local Setup

BounceForge processes inbound bounce notifications and exposes plugin hooks at classify, suppress, and report stages. Plugin authors: clone the SDK repo, run `make dev`, and drop your plugin under `plugins/`. Hooks must be idempotent; the processor replays batches on failure. Test fixtures live in `fixtures/bounces/` — load them with `make seed`. The processor persists suppression lists and bounce events to a local datastore; plugins read from it via the provided client. Configure it with the connection string below.

replica DSN, kajep-yahag: mssql://praok_svc:iF@db-8d68.plorvaio.local:5432/eliion

Heads up: the LiftLine dispatch simulator is throwing queue-depth warnings again. Basically the fake elevators are stacking up on floor 12 and the allocator can't drain them fast enough. Not customer-facing, but it blocks the nightly regression run for Team Skybank. Restarting the sim worker usually clears it. Details are on the internal wiki page.

operations page: https://jira.qorvelsys.internal/browse/pages/browse/pages